 | package proto_test | 
 |  | 
 | import ( | 
 | 	"testing" | 
 |  | 
 | 	. "github.com/golang/protobuf/proto" | 
 | 	proto3pb "github.com/golang/protobuf/proto/proto3_proto" | 
 | 	pb "github.com/golang/protobuf/proto/testdata" | 
 | ) | 
 |  | 
 | // Four identical base messages. | 
 | // The init function adds extensions to some of them. | 
 | var messageWithoutExtension = &pb.MyMessage{Count: Int32(7)} | 
 | var messageWithExtension1a = &pb.MyMessage{Count: Int32(7)} | 
 | var messageWithExtension1b = &pb.MyMessage{Count: Int32(7)} | 
 | var messageWithExtension2 = &pb.MyMessage{Count: Int32(7)} | 
 |  | 
 | // Two messages with non-message extensions. | 
 | var messageWithInt32Extension1 = &pb.MyMessage{Count: Int32(8)} | 
 | var messageWithInt32Extension2 = &pb.MyMessage{Count: Int32(8)} | 
 |  | 
 | func init() { | 
 | 	ext1 := &pb.Ext{Data: String("Kirk")} | 
 | 	ext2 := &pb.Ext{Data: String("Picard")} | 
 |  | 
 | 	// messageWithExtension1a has ext1, but never marshals it. | 
 | 	if err := SetExtension(messageWithExtension1a, pb.E_Ext_More, ext1); err != nil { | 
 | 		panic("SetExtension on 1a failed: " + err.Error()) | 
 | 	} | 
 |  | 
 | 	// messageWithExtension1b is the unmarshaled form of messageWithExtension1a. | 
 | 	if err := SetExtension(messageWithExtension1b, pb.E_Ext_More, ext1); err != nil { | 
 | 		panic("SetExtension on 1b failed: " + err.Error()) | 
 | 	} | 
 | 	buf, err := Marshal(messageWithExtension1b) | 
 | 	if err != nil { | 
 | 		panic("Marshal of 1b failed: " + err.Error()) | 
 | 	} | 
 | 	messageWithExtension1b.Reset() | 
 | 	if err := Unmarshal(buf, messageWithExtension1b); err != nil { | 
 | 		panic("Unmarshal of 1b failed: " + err.Error()) | 
 | 	} | 
 |  | 
 | 	// messageWithExtension2 has ext2. | 
 | 	if err := SetExtension(messageWithExtension2, pb.E_Ext_More, ext2); err != nil { | 
 | 		panic("SetExtension on 2 failed: " + err.Error()) | 
 | 	} | 
 |  | 
 | 	if err := SetExtension(messageWithInt32Extension1, pb.E_Ext_Number, Int32(23)); err != nil { | 
 | 		panic("SetExtension on Int32-1 failed: " + err.Error()) | 
 | 	} | 
 | 	if err := SetExtension(messageWithInt32Extension1, pb.E_Ext_Number, Int32(24)); err != nil { | 
 | 		panic("SetExtension on Int32-2 failed: " + err.Error()) | 
 | 	} |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| var EqualTests = []struct { | 
 | 	desc string | 
 | 	a, b Message | 
 | 	exp  bool | 
 | }{ | 
 | 	{"different types", &pb.GoEnum{}, &pb.GoTestField{}, false}, | 
 | 	{"equal empty", &pb.GoEnum{}, &pb.GoEnum{}, true}, | 
 | 	{"nil vs nil", nil, nil, true}, | 
 | 	{"typed nil vs typed nil", (*pb.GoEnum)(nil), (*pb.GoEnum)(nil), true}, | 
 | 	{"typed nil vs empty", (*pb.GoEnum)(nil), &pb.GoEnum{}, false}, | 
 | 	{"different typed nil", (*pb.GoEnum)(nil), (*pb.GoTestField)(nil), false}, | 
 |  | 
 | 	{"one set field, one unset field", &pb.GoTestField{Label: String("foo")}, &pb.GoTestField{}, false}, | 
 | 	{"one set field zero, one unset field", &pb.GoTest{Param: Int32(0)}, &pb.GoTest{}, false}, | 
 | 	{"different set fields", &pb.GoTestField{Label: String("foo")}, &pb.GoTestField{Label: String("bar")}, false}, | 
 | 	{"equal set", &pb.GoTestField{Label: String("foo")}, &pb.GoTestField{Label: String("foo")}, true}, | 
 |  | 
 | 	{"repeated, one set", &pb.GoTest{F_Int32Repeated: []int32{2, 3}}, &pb.GoTest{}, false}, | 
 | 	{"repeated, different length", &pb.GoTest{F_Int32Repeated: []int32{2, 3}}, &pb.GoTest{F_Int32Repeated: []int32{2}}, false}, | 
 | 	{"repeated, different value", &pb.GoTest{F_Int32Repeated: []int32{2}}, &pb.GoTest{F_Int32Repeated: []int32{3}}, false}, | 
 | 	{"repeated, equal", &pb.GoTest{F_Int32Repeated: []int32{2, 4}}, &pb.GoTest{F_Int32Repeated: []int32{2, 4}}, true}, | 
 | 	{"repeated, nil equal nil", &pb.GoTest{F_Int32Repeated: nil}, &pb.GoTest{F_Int32Repeated: nil}, true}, | 
 | 	{"repeated, nil equal empty", &pb.GoTest{F_Int32Repeated: nil}, &pb.GoTest{F_Int32Repeated: []int32{}}, true}, | 
 | 	{"repeated, empty equal nil", &pb.GoTest{F_Int32Repeated: []int32{}}, &pb.GoTest{F_Int32Repeated: nil}, true}, | 
 |  | 
 | 	{ | 
 | 		"nested, different", | 
 | 		&pb.GoTest{RequiredField: &pb.GoTestField{Label: String("foo")}}, | 
 | 		&pb.GoTest{RequiredField: &pb.GoTestField{Label: String("bar")}}, | 
 | 		false, | 
 | 	}, | 
 | 	{ | 
 | 		"nested, equal", | 
 | 		&pb.GoTest{RequiredField: &pb.GoTestField{Label: String("wow")}}, | 
 | 		&pb.GoTest{RequiredField: &pb.GoTestField{Label: String("wow")}}, | 
 | 		true, | 
 | 	}, | 
 |  | 
 | 	{"bytes", &pb.OtherMessage{Value: []byte("foo")}, &pb.OtherMessage{Value: []byte("foo")}, true}, | 
 | 	{"bytes, empty", &pb.OtherMessage{Value: []byte{}}, &pb.OtherMessage{Value: []byte{}}, true}, | 
 | 	{"bytes, empty vs nil", &pb.OtherMessage{Value: []byte{}}, &pb.OtherMessage{Value: nil}, false}, | 
 | 	{ | 
 | 		"repeated bytes", | 
 | 		&pb.MyMessage{RepBytes: [][]byte{[]byte("sham"), []byte("wow")}}, | 
 | 		&pb.MyMessage{RepBytes: [][]byte{[]byte("sham"), []byte("wow")}}, | 
 | 		true, | 
 | 	}, | 
 | 	// In proto3, []byte{} and []byte(nil) are equal. | 
 | 	{"proto3 bytes, empty vs nil", &proto3pb.Message{Data: []byte{}}, &proto3pb.Message{Data: nil}, true}, | 
 |  | 
 | 	{"extension vs. no extension", messageWithoutExtension, messageWithExtension1a, false}, | 
 | 	{"extension vs. same extension", messageWithExtension1a, messageWithExtension1b, true}, | 
 | 	{"extension vs. different extension", messageWithExtension1a, messageWithExtension2, false}, | 
 |  | 
 | 	{"int32 extension vs. itself", messageWithInt32Extension1, messageWithInt32Extension1, true}, | 
 | 	{"int32 extension vs. a different int32", messageWithInt32Extension1, messageWithInt32Extension2, false}, | 
 |  | 
 | 	{ | 
 | 		"message with group", | 
 | 		&pb.MyMessage{ | 
 | 			Count: Int32(1), | 
 | 			Somegroup: &pb.MyMessage_SomeGroup{ | 
 | 				GroupField: Int32(5), | 
 | 			}, | 
 | 		}, | 
 | 		&pb.MyMessage{ | 
 | 			Count: Int32(1), | 
 | 			Somegroup: &pb.MyMessage_SomeGroup{ | 
 | 				GroupField: Int32(5), | 
 | 			}, | 
 | 		}, | 
 | 		true, | 
 | 	}, | 
 |  | 
 | 	{ | 
 | 		"map same", | 
 | 		&pb.MessageWithMap{NameMapping: map[int32]string{1: "Ken"}}, | 
 | 		&pb.MessageWithMap{NameMapping: map[int32]string{1: "Ken"}}, | 
 | 		true, | 
 | 	}, | 
 | 	{ | 
 | 		"map different entry", | 
 | 		&pb.MessageWithMap{NameMapping: map[int32]string{1: "Ken"}}, | 
 | 		&pb.MessageWithMap{NameMapping: map[int32]string{2: "Rob"}}, | 
 | 		false, | 
 | 	}, | 
 | 	{ | 
 | 		"map different key only", | 
 | 		&pb.MessageWithMap{NameMapping: map[int32]string{1: "Ken"}}, | 
 | 		&pb.MessageWithMap{NameMapping: map[int32]string{2: "Ken"}}, | 
 | 		false, | 
 | 	}, | 
 | 	{ | 
 | 		"map different value only", | 
 | 		&pb.MessageWithMap{NameMapping: map[int32]string{1: "Ken"}}, | 
 | 		&pb.MessageWithMap{NameMapping: map[int32]string{1: "Rob"}}, | 
 | 		false, | 
 | 	}, | 
 | 	{ | 
 | 		"zero-length maps same", | 
 | 		&pb.MessageWithMap{NameMapping: map[int32]string{}}, | 
 | 		&pb.MessageWithMap{NameMapping: nil}, | 
 | 		true, | 
 | 	}, | 
 | 	{ | 
 | 		"orders in map don't matter", | 
 | 		&pb.MessageWithMap{NameMapping: map[int32]string{1: "Ken", 2: "Rob"}}, | 
 | 		&pb.MessageWithMap{NameMapping: map[int32]string{2: "Rob", 1: "Ken"}}, | 
 | 		true, | 
 | 	}, | 
 | 	{ | 
 | 		"oneof same", | 
 | 		&pb.Communique{Union: &pb.Communique_Number{41}}, | 
 | 		&pb.Communique{Union: &pb.Communique_Number{41}}, | 
 | 		true, | 
 | 	}, | 
 | 	{ | 
 | 		"oneof one nil", | 
 | 		&pb.Communique{Union: &pb.Communique_Number{41}}, | 
 | 		&pb.Communique{}, | 
 | 		false, | 
 | 	}, | 
 | 	{ | 
 | 		"oneof different", | 
 | 		&pb.Communique{Union: &pb.Communique_Number{41}}, | 
 | 		&pb.Communique{Union: &pb.Communique_Name{"Bobby Tables"}}, | 
 | 		false, | 
 | 	}, |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| func TestEqual(t *testing.T) { | 
 | 	for _, tc := range EqualTests { | 
 | 		if res := Equal(tc.a, tc.b); res != tc.exp { | 
 | 			t.Errorf("%v: Equal(%v, %v) = %v, want %v", tc.desc, tc.a, tc.b, res, tc.exp) | 
 | 		} | 
 | 	} | 
 | } |
